    Introduction to IoT Platforms

    IoT platforms are the backbone of modern connected devices. They provide the infrastructure needed to manage, monitor, and analyze data from IoT devices. A remote IoT platform for Raspberry Pi allows developers to control and interact with their devices from anywhere in the world.

    When selecting a platform, it's essential to consider factors such as ease of use, compatibility, and scalability. The best remote IoT platform for Raspberry Pi should offer robust features that support both small-scale projects and enterprise-level applications.

    Why is a remote IoT platform important? It enables you to manage your Raspberry Pi projects remotely, ensuring seamless operation and reducing downtime. This is particularly crucial for projects that require real-time data processing and monitoring.

    Raspberry Pi Overview

    Raspberry Pi is a popular single-board computer used by developers, hobbyists, and educators worldwide. Its affordability, versatility, and open-source nature make it an ideal choice for IoT projects. With its GPIO pins and support for various programming languages, Raspberry Pi offers endless possibilities for innovation.

    Some key features of Raspberry Pi include:

    • Compact and lightweight design
    • Support for multiple operating systems
    • Compatibility with various sensors and peripherals
    • Strong community support and extensive documentation

    When paired with the right IoT platform, Raspberry Pi can become a powerful tool for developing smart home systems, industrial automation, and environmental monitoring solutions.

    Top Remote IoT Platforms for Raspberry Pi

    1. AWS IoT Core

    AWS IoT Core is a cloud-based platform that allows you to connect and manage millions of devices. It supports MQTT, HTTP, and WebSockets protocols, making it compatible with Raspberry Pi. AWS IoT Core offers features such as device shadowing, rules engine, and over-the-air updates.

    2. Microsoft Azure IoT Hub

    Microsoft Azure IoT Hub is another popular choice for Raspberry Pi projects. It provides secure communication between devices and the cloud, as well as tools for device management and monitoring. Azure IoT Hub integrates seamlessly with other Azure services, enabling you to build end-to-end IoT solutions.

    3. Google Cloud IoT Core

    Google Cloud IoT Core is a fully managed service that allows you to securely connect and manage IoT devices. It supports MQTT and HTTP protocols and integrates with Google's powerful data analytics tools. With its scalable architecture, Google Cloud IoT Core is suitable for both small and large-scale projects.

    Security Considerations

    Security is a top priority when working with IoT devices. Here are some best practices to ensure the security of your Raspberry Pi projects:

    • Use strong passwords and two-factor authentication
    • Regularly update firmware and software
    • Implement encryption for data transmission
    • Monitor device activity for suspicious behavior

    By following these practices, you can minimize the risk of security breaches and protect your devices and data.
